Does your teen have questions about gender and sexuality? Are they interested in learning how to create inclusive spaces for themselves and their peers? Sign them up for our Gender & Inclusion Workshop! We will be using the "Rights, Respect, Responsibility" curriculum created by Advocates for Youth to present a two-night workshop on gender, sexuality, inclusion, and advocacy.
The workshop will be held over two evenings, and teens must commit to both: Wednesday, July 24th and Thursday, July 25th from 6 - 8:30p. Teens should bring their own snacks/dinner (or money to go and get something to eat) as we will be taking a meal break around 7pm. Workshop materials will be provided.
This workshop is meant for teens aged 13 - 15 only. It will be capped at 12 people. The cost is $50 per person and required in advance (through the ticketing link). Once we've received your payment, we will email you a link to get more information about your teen.
The workshop will be led by Card Carrying Books & Gifts co-founder Sarah, who worked as a sexuality educator prior to running the bookstore. She has also been trained in crisis counseling, first aid, and suicide prevention.
